Martin Preuss
|
8ae50a8d60
|
fixed flashnode.sh for n24, added n25
|
2025-06-01 22:37:46 +02:00 |
|
Martin Preuss
|
08411d9430
|
NET_IFACE_OFFS_HANDLED_LOW no longer exists.
|
2025-06-01 22:37:26 +02:00 |
|
Martin Preuss
|
9bd3182bd5
|
simplified timer and sleep setup code for AtTiny84.
|
2025-06-01 22:36:59 +02:00 |
|
Martin Preuss
|
c45eb6cca2
|
fixed blinkled fn: always switch LED port to output.
|
2025-06-01 22:36:26 +02:00 |
|
Martin Preuss
|
b229b39ab8
|
c02: started working on AtMEGA 644P based node.
|
2025-06-01 19:26:31 +02:00 |
|
Martin Preuss
|
87b5e01581
|
add missing include.
|
2025-06-01 19:25:57 +02:00 |
|
Martin Preuss
|
8188f33345
|
uart_bitbang2: introduced macros for ATTN irq setup.
|
2025-06-01 19:25:47 +02:00 |
|
Martin Preuss
|
7403b6650b
|
n24: include common/calls.asm
|
2025-06-01 19:25:16 +02:00 |
|
Martin Preuss
|
6bbf2ba788
|
c01: use UART_BitBang_PcintIsr
|
2025-06-01 19:24:49 +02:00 |
|
Martin Preuss
|
06b0ed8551
|
c01: fixed include.
|
2025-06-01 19:24:13 +02:00 |
|
Martin Preuss
|
ada19028e0
|
dont use old constant.
|
2025-06-01 19:23:38 +02:00 |
|
Martin Preuss
|
1e5de0da23
|
flash: use 16-bit counters.
|
2025-06-01 19:22:04 +02:00 |
|
Martin Preuss
|
bb14dd4c22
|
introduce macros bigjmp and bigcall for intermodule calls/jmps
translates to rjmp/rcall on MCUs with up to 8K flash and to jmp/call
on others.
|
2025-06-01 19:18:25 +02:00 |
|
Martin Preuss
|
188e7da379
|
incremented firmware version.
|
2025-06-01 00:21:52 +02:00 |
|
Martin Preuss
|
982c9bd649
|
re-enable some modules and apps on n20.
|
2025-06-01 00:21:37 +02:00 |
|
Martin Preuss
|
fec37bd221
|
disable debug code.
|
2025-06-01 00:21:21 +02:00 |
|
Martin Preuss
|
120e3e1e6b
|
uart bitbang2 now also works on c01!
|
2025-06-01 00:21:07 +02:00 |
|
Martin Preuss
|
8d1661d8e4
|
improved output from "getdevices" command.
|
2025-06-01 00:20:28 +02:00 |
|
Martin Preuss
|
18f61f4d63
|
added include for debug functions (commented-out).
|
2025-05-31 15:37:31 +02:00 |
|
Martin Preuss
|
be74442e7f
|
receiving works again.
|
2025-05-31 15:36:52 +02:00 |
|
Martin Preuss
|
061119819f
|
sending works again with n20.
|
2025-05-31 14:20:05 +02:00 |
|
Martin Preuss
|
0b8cb929b7
|
split uart_bitbang2 into multiple files.
|
2025-05-30 17:03:35 +02:00 |
|
Martin Preuss
|
f1c858e3a7
|
Use n20 for bugfixing.
|
2025-05-30 15:25:42 +02:00 |
|
Martin Preuss
|
3fc7eff424
|
add n20.
|
2025-05-29 22:54:25 +02:00 |
|
Martin Preuss
|
36050b14c5
|
wait for one bitlength between bytes. disable collision detection.
|
2025-05-29 21:04:30 +02:00 |
|
Martin Preuss
|
fa6acd8e52
|
added aqua_n25.xml
|
2025-05-29 20:27:07 +02:00 |
|
Martin Preuss
|
dbf7f76baa
|
moved versions to a dedicated file shared by all nodes.
|
2025-05-29 20:26:43 +02:00 |
|
Martin Preuss
|
18be337160
|
minor change
|
2025-05-29 20:25:49 +02:00 |
|
Martin Preuss
|
0bd6ef8db4
|
fix defs for n24.
|
2025-05-29 20:25:34 +02:00 |
|
Martin Preuss
|
7fb1722c70
|
added missing .include
|
2025-05-29 20:25:07 +02:00 |
|
Martin Preuss
|
279d92e338
|
prepared removal of defs_all.asm
|
2025-05-29 20:24:41 +02:00 |
|
Martin Preuss
|
a26dd6f2a5
|
added stats vars to n21
|
2025-05-29 20:24:13 +02:00 |
|
Martin Preuss
|
785e4ef28c
|
added n16
|
2025-05-29 20:23:53 +02:00 |
|
Martin Preuss
|
dff347bcb7
|
created pong message.
|
2025-05-29 20:23:44 +02:00 |
|
Martin Preuss
|
619ac1564e
|
debug: send rxstats every minute.
|
2025-05-29 20:20:43 +02:00 |
|
Martin Preuss
|
581eeff996
|
apps/network: implemented ping request.
|
2025-05-29 15:47:21 +02:00 |
|
Martin Preuss
|
b4e747c3db
|
added header.
|
2025-05-29 15:44:30 +02:00 |
|
Martin Preuss
|
04dec73988
|
added device n25
|
2025-05-29 15:43:33 +02:00 |
|
Martin Preuss
|
af75532ba7
|
More planning on GUI.
|
2025-05-28 19:03:14 +02:00 |
|
Martin Preuss
|
335163f887
|
temporarily disabled writing text on startup (need the flash space).
|
2025-05-28 00:52:40 +02:00 |
|
Martin Preuss
|
b3274466a3
|
smaller changes to make debugging easier.
|
2025-05-28 00:52:06 +02:00 |
|
Martin Preuss
|
064e84f5e8
|
added a more compact uart module.
|
2025-05-28 00:51:37 +02:00 |
|
Martin Preuss
|
18bc231951
|
added some test code.
|
2025-05-28 00:51:07 +02:00 |
|
Martin Preuss
|
9a19bf739d
|
fixed a bug (wrong register).
|
2025-05-28 00:50:52 +02:00 |
|
Martin Preuss
|
9e6feecb88
|
bootloader: decreased waiting times for LED blinking on bootup.
|
2025-05-28 00:50:26 +02:00 |
|
Martin Preuss
|
baf77ed182
|
fixed defs file.
|
2025-05-28 00:49:44 +02:00 |
|
Martin Preuss
|
b2f7232422
|
c01: use alternative uart module.
|
2025-05-28 00:49:28 +02:00 |
|
Martin Preuss
|
961568f721
|
renamed makros M_IO_READ and M_IO_WRITE to inr and outr
|
2025-05-28 00:49:07 +02:00 |
|
Martin Preuss
|
042db13994
|
avr/apps/stats: send VALUE_REPORT messages instead of individual stats messages.
this makes it easier to add some more stats later and it removes some
messages.
|
2025-05-28 00:47:19 +02:00 |
|
Martin Preuss
|
ba434d88a2
|
improved output.
|
2025-05-28 00:45:10 +02:00 |
|